Case Study: When Tesla's Big Battery Played Chicken with Aussie Grid Operators

Remember the 2017 Hornsdale Power Reserve installation? Operators initially rejected its connection proposal for being "too responsive." Turns out the 100MW/129MWh system's lightning-fast reaction time (140 milliseconds!) actually prevented 8 potential blackouts in its first year. Sometimes grid rules need to catch up with innovation!

When Paperwork Meets Physics: The Interconnection Queue Shuffle

Here's where most projects trip up. The energy storage grid connection process currently faces:

  • Average 3.5-year wait times in U.S. interconnection queues
  • 45% chance of project cancellation during studies
  • $250k+ in upfront engineering costs (non-refundable if rejected)

Pro tip: New "cluster study" approaches are cutting approval times faster than a Tesla Plaid's 0-60 time. ERCOT (Texas grid) recently processed 593 storage projects in one batch - that's more connections than a Tinder power user makes in a year!

Germany's Grid Connection Hack: Storage Speed Dating Events

Through standardized "connection templates," the Bundesnetzagentur has reduced approval times from 24 months to 8 months for projects under 10MW. Their secret sauce? Pre-approved technical configurations that make storage-grid matches as smooth as a Berlin techno beat.

The $64,000 Question: Can AI Play Matchmaker?

Machine learning algorithms are now predicting grid connection outcomes with 89% accuracy, according to NREL's 2023 study. Startups like Pearl Street Technologies use digital twins to simulate grid dates before real-world commitment. One developer avoided $2M in upgrade costs by virtually "testing" 17 connection scenarios - that's cheaper than a Kardashian wedding!
